First, she sent fans into a tizzy by tapping into the viral Barbiecore trend with a blonde wig, and now Selena Gomez is coming for Oppenheimer. The actor and superstar recently took to Instagram with some goth-inspired black nails, artfully distressed hair, and heavily kohl-rimmed eyes. Moving away from her usual polished ponytails, pristine lip gloss nails, and her signature feline flick, it was a marked departure from her signature aesthetic and a welcome opener for the candid carousel of “randemz” pics that ensued.

Selena is not the only A-lister to turn to the dark side with actors Lily Collins and Lucy Boynton channeling their inner goth respectively as they took to the red carpet; Lily with her vampy rouge noir lip, burnt orange eye, and intricate braided up-do and Lucy with her charcoal and grey smokey eye and glistening teardrop jewel.

Looking to try this moody, gothic trend? A macabre manicure is the perfect place to start. Just look at Olivia Rodrigo who debuted some bitten black nails on her angsty album cover for Guts. The key to this look is obviously its color: midnight black. And there are some currently great options out there — Sally Hansen’s Black to Black, Jinsoon’s Absolute Black, and Essie’s Licorice to name a few. Add to this bucket loads of attitude, lashings of kohl and you should be good to go.
